InDesign Certification
The role of the desktop publisher is to combine text and graphics
together into finished products, which include printed works and PDF
files. Sample documents include everything from business cards to books,
fliers to brochures, and reports to advertisements, from print to web.
Adobe InDesign is a high-end desktop publishing program geared towards
professional and/or advanced users.
Although this is not a career certificate, this award will enhance the
recipient's value in the job market. Desktop publishing is recognized
by the U.S.
Department of Labor as one of the fastest growing occupations in the
years 2000-2010 and requires only a Postsecondary vocational award.
This certificate prepares the student for the Adobe
Certified Expert (ACE) industry exam in InDesign. In addition to the preparation provided by this certificate, desktop publishers should also have a good understanding of design, layout, typography, and color. A good desktop publisher is detail oriented and creative.
